Responsibilities

  • Collect, organize, and analyze procurement data to track purchasing trends and identify opportunities for cost savings.
  • Prepare reports on supplier performance, spend analysis, and procurement activities.
  • Assist in forecasting and budgeting by providing insights into future purchasing needs and trends.
  • Support the procurement team in identifying potential suppliers and conducting supplier evaluations.
  • Assist in maintaining and managing supplier relationships, monitoring Purchase Orders and payments to key suppliers.
  • Monitor supplier performance and address issues as they arise, working to resolve discrepancies.
  • Identify inefficiencies in the procurement process and propose solutions to streamline operations.
  • Develop and implement strategies to optimize purchasing practices, reducing costs and increasing process effectiveness.
  • Assist in the preparation and management of purchase orders and contracts, as well as ensuring the required approvals are obtained.
  • Ensure that procurement activities align with company policies, compliance requirements, and industry standards.
  • Maintain an accurate record of orders, contracts, and agreements, ensuring that all documentation is up-to-date.
  • Conduct market research to stay informed about industry trends, product innovations, and new suppliers.
  • Provide recommendations to improve purchasing strategies and explore potential cost-saving opportunities.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ams, including finance, operations, and legal, to ensure procurement needs are met and compliant.
  • Communicate with suppliers to obtain quotes, negotiate terms, and address any issues that may arise.
